MooseX::Declare::Syntax::Keyword::Namespace - Declare outer namespace
use MooseX::Declare; namespace Foo::Bar; class ::Baz extends ::Qux with ::Fnording { ... }
The namespace keyword allows you to declare an outer namespace under which other namespaced constructs can be nested. The "SYNOPSIS" is effectively the same as
namespace
use MooseX::Declare; class Foo::Bar::Baz extends Foo::Bar::Qux with Foo::Bar::Fnording { ... }
Object->parse(Object $context)
Will skip the declarator, parse the namespace and push the namespace in the file package stack.
